A slight frown had appeared upon his forehead.
"Do you know him ?" she asked.
"I know who he is," he answered.

"He is a queer sort of fellow, lives all alone, and is a bit cranky, they say.

Come in and have some breakfast.

I don't suppose that any one else will be down for ages." She shook her head.
"I will send my woman down for some coffee," she answered.

"I am going upstairs to change.
